A portfolio has two assets; A & B. Asset A has an expected return of 5% and a standard deviation of return of 2%. Asset B, on the other hand, has an expected return of 12% and a standard deviation of return of 5%. The covariance of return is 7.5(%)2. What are the portfolio's expected return and standard deviation, if 50% of the portfolio is in asset A?
